We invite applications for a Postdoc position (fixed term, salary level E 13 TV-L, 100%) in the new research group on Early Universe Cosmology of Prof. Dr. Julia Harz within the Theoretical High Energy Physics (THEP) Group at the University of Mainz. The research interests of the group lie in theoretical particle physics of the early Universe, in particular connected, but not limited to, dark matter physics, baryogenesis and neutrino physics. Our investigations tackle both phenomenology and the advancement of methods.

The appointment is initially for two years with the possibility of a one year extension. The earliest possible starting date is October 1st 2022. Applicants should have successfully completed a university degree and hold a PhD in theoretical physics and preferably have previous research experience in topics aligned to the research interests of the group.

With around 31000 students from over 120 nations, Johannes Gutenberg University Mainz (JGU) is one of the largest and most diverse universities in Germany. JGU enjoys global eminence as a research-driven university and won in Germany's competitive Excellence Strategy program the cluster of excellence PRISMA+ (Precision Physics, Fundamental Interactions and Structure of Matter). PRISMA+ hosts the Mainz Institute for Theoretical Physics (MITP) which provides unique opportunities for cross-disciplinary exchange between researchers from different fields of expertise in theoretical physics by holding a series of scientific programs and short topical workshops to attract leading international researchers.
